Transaction 671a336dba08ffc7151ba6bfcc72b2623c27b81d8ee5c64f568d7f811893a8cd

1 Input
2 Outputs
  • 671a336dba08ffc7151ba6bfcc72b2623c27b81d8ee5c64f568d7f811893a8cd:0
  • value  3500000
    address  14kj69Zk5HPS16i1p9BwfVsDLUYfCHBvG4
  • 671a336dba08ffc7151ba6bfcc72b2623c27b81d8ee5c64f568d7f811893a8cd:1
  • value  294987
    address  1PKg9WUDKPUNZFbgA8Jt6Ku8mRuGkVrEvi